Fourth album and German tour for McLoughlin
Newry singer-songwriter Tony McLoughlin will release his fourth album Ride The Wind on August 2
It was produced by fellow-Northerner Ben Reel, and McLoughlin will follow the album's release with a tour of Germany that will include the Waldbuhne Festival in Hamburg on Sunday August 10 and gigs in Saarland during the following week.
This is McLoughlin's first album to be recorded in Ireland and features a band drawn for various parts of Ulster, including the afore-mentioned Reel on guitars and percussion, Ronnie O'Flynn on bass and percussion, Michael Black on drums and John McCullogh on keyboards.
